CUNNINGHAM v. SPITZ


218 A.D.2d 639 (1995)

630 N.Y.S.2d 341

Elton Cunningham et al., Respondents, v. Leon Spitz et al., Appellants

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

August 7, 1995


Ordered that the order is affirmed, with costs.

The plaintiffs raise triable issues of fact as to whether the plaintiff Elton Cunningham was injured as a result of his exposure to lead, notwithstanding the fact that his blood-lead level did not fall within scientifically accepted definitions of lead poisoning.
